‘A Merry Little Ex-Mas’
Kate (Alicia Silverstone) is recently divorced and all she wants for Christmas is one last holiday as a family in her home before they sell. But when her ex-husband, Everett (Oliver Hudson), comes home with a younger, beautiful new girlfriend, things go awry, especially as old feelings start to resurface and get in the way of new plans.
“It’s just charming and lovely,” Silverstone said of the film. “I produced that one, and we’ve got great people in it. Oliver Hudson plays my husband, who I’m divorcing, and Pierson Fodé plays my boyfriend.”

‘Champagne Problems’
A new holiday romance film starring Minka Kelly and Tom Wozniczka dropped on Netflix on November 19. The description provided by the streaming service says, “A driven American exec heads to Paris determined to acquire a champagne brand by Christmas — and accidentally falls for the heir to the bubbly empire.”
“She’s this singularly-focused businesswoman who gets this huge opportunity to secure a campaign in Paris,” Kelly says of her character. “So, she goes out there and her sister convinces her to take one day off to enjoy the sights. She ends up meeting this very charming Frenchman in a bookstore and everything gets derailed.”

‘Jingle Bell Heist’
What’s Christmas without a little bit of comedy? Jingle Bell Heist is Netflix’s newest holiday drop and romantic comedy starring Olivia Holt and Connor Swindells. When two unlucky, hourly workers plot to work together to rob a fancy store in London, unexpected feelings begin to fly between them.
“This was so much fun,” Holt shared about the film. “It has elements of action and romance and mystery that are all genres and worlds that I love.”
Swindells said of the movie, “What drew me most to the project was the excitement of making something silly and joyful again. I’ve always wanted to make a Christmas movie.”

‘My Secret Santa’
Alexandra Breckenridge stars as single-mom, Taylor, who finds herself in need of a job and comes up with a crazy plan: she will disguise herself as a man and portray Santa Claus at a fancy ski resort. The only question is will the resort’s heir believe her ruse and hire her?
“It’s close to Mrs. Doubtfire—this is similar in that she doesn’t have a job,” Breckenridge explained. “She’s desperate to pay her rent, plus send her daughter to this snowboarding school, because she wants to provide everything that she possibly can for her daughter. But she’s a single parent. It’s very difficult for her, and she’s just lost her job during Christmas.”
